// Notes for the weekly eng sync re: Gallerywhisper, our museum audio-guide app.
// This constant sets the prefetch radius for exhibit audio clips. At the
// Hollen Pavilion pilot we learned visitors walk faster than our original
// estimate, so clips were buffering mid-stride. Bumping this to three rooms
// ahead fixed it, at a modest bandwidth cost. Don't lower it without testing
// on the slow gallery wifi first — seriously, it's painful. The trace token
// from the pilot build that validated this number is appended just below.

trace token, kahap-bagaf: htk4_8458

Action item from the Wrenhall Gallery audio-guide postmortem: the TourStream app cached stale exhibit manifests after the midnight sync job failed silently, leaving visitors with mismatched narration for three hours. Please review the retry wrapper in the manifest fetcher carefully — it swallows timeout exceptions and logs them at debug level only, which is why nothing alerted. We want the fix to raise on the third failure and page on-call. The full incident timeline and logs are posted on the internal wiki page below.

wiki page, yajof-tafof: https://confluence.lumiclabs.internal/display/projects/projects/projects

When sizing hardware for the Ortelli kiosk fleet, remember that the watchdog itself consumes a measurable share of CPU on the low-end units. Each health probe wakes the display process, so overly aggressive intervals inflate baseline load and skew capacity estimates. Plan headroom assuming the watchdog defaults below, and flag any proposed changes to the platform channel before adjusting them. The current constants are as follows.

constants for fajop-tahaf:
RATE_LIMITS = {
    "holael": 2,
    "oliael": 10,
    "druael": 10,
    "wenwyn": 10,
}

Handover — Vexler partner SFTP drop

Ownership moves to you today. Drop runs hourly from Vexler's end into the intake bucket via the relay host. Watch for zero-byte files; their exporter flakes on Mondays. Creds live in the ops vault, path noted in the runbook. Vault auto-seals after 48h idle. Support escalations go to the on-call rotation, not me. If the vault is sealed when you need it, unseal with the recovery passphrase below.

recovery phrase for tadug-fafof: zorwyn-kasion